Basic Information of Protein
UniProt ID NANO1_HUMAN
UniProt AC Q8WY41
Protein Name Nanos homolog 1
Gene Name NANOS1
Organism Homo sapiens (Human).
Sequence Length 292
Subcellular Localization Cytoplasm, perinuclear region . Cytoplasm . Colocalizes with SNAPIN and PUM2 in the perinuclear region of germ cells.
Protein Description May act as a translational repressor which regulates translation of specific mRNAs by forming a complex with PUM2 that associates with the 3'-UTR of mRNA targets. Capable of interfering with the proadhesive and anti-invasive functions of E-cadherin. Up-regulates the production of MMP14 to promote tumor cell invasion..
